What is Angioplasty Surgery?

Angioplasty is a minimally invasive procedure used to open blocked arteries in the heart. It involves inserting a small balloon into the artery, which is then inflated to remove blockages. Often, a stent is placed to keep the artery open permanently. This helps restore blood flow, easing chest pain and significantly lowering the risk of a heart attack.

Benefits of Angioplasty Surgery

1. Immediate Relief from Angina (Chest Pain)

Living with chest pain can be terrifying. Each twinge feels like a potential emergency. After angioplasty surgery, many patients report immediate relief from chest pain, allowing them to breathe easy and live without fear.

2. Prevents Heart Attacks

Heart attacks are often caused by blocked arteries. Angioplasty helps prevent these life-threatening events by ensuring blood can flow freely to the heart, giving patients a chance to live longer and healthier lives.

3. Minimally Invasive Procedure

The thought of surgery can be intimidating, but angioplasty is less invasive than traditional heart surgery. It involves a small incision, typically in the wrist or leg, and does not require opening the chest. This leads to faster recovery and less pain for the patient.

4. Short Recovery Time

With angioplasty, recovery is much quicker compared to other surgeries. Most patients are able to go home within a day or two and return to their normal activities shortly after. This means you can get back to your life faster, without the long hospital stays.

5. Long-Term Benefits

Angioplasty doesn’t just offer immediate relief — it also brings long-term health benefits. With proper care, lifestyle changes, and medication, patients can enjoy years of improved heart health after the procedure.

2. How long does the angioplasty procedure take?

The procedure usually takes between 30 minutes to two hours, depending on the complexity of the blockage.

3. Can I go home the same day after angioplasty?

In most cases, patients can go home within 24–48 hours after the procedure. Your doctor will determine the best timeline based on your recovery.

6. Can angioplasty prevent future heart attacks?

Yes, angioplasty can reduce the risk of future heart attacks by improving blood flow to the heart. However, it’s important to maintain a heart-healthy lifestyle after the procedure.

7. Will I need medication after angioplasty?

Yes, you will likely need to take blood thinners and other medications after angioplasty to prevent further blockages and ensure the success of the procedure.

8. How do I know if I need angioplasty surgery?

Your doctor may recommend angioplasty if you have narrowed or blocked arteries that are causing chest pain or increasing your risk of a heart attack.

9. Can lifestyle changes reduce the need for angioplasty?

Lifestyle changes such as eating a healthy diet, exercising regularly, and quitting smoking can significantly reduce the need for angioplasty. However, if your arteries are already blocked, angioplasty may still be necessary.
